Whispers of the Fated Triangle: The Triangle's Redemption
In the heart of the ancient realm of Aeloria, where the world was woven from the threads of fate and destiny, there lay a triangle—a triangle not of stone or metal, but of the very essence of existence. The Triangle of Fates, as it was known, was the arbiter of all fates, the guiding force that shaped the destinies of every soul. Its edges were etched with the stories of creation and annihilation, love and loss, and the unbreakable bonds of fate.
Centuries ago, during the twilight of the Age of Eternity, the Triangle of Fates was divided into three distinct beings: Aelion, the protector of life; Ilios, the guardian of the arcane; and Lyria, the weaver of dreams. Bound by an unbreakable triangle, they were the architects of the world's existence, their wills as powerful as the winds of destiny.
The triangle's balance was maintained by their shared love for a single soul, a human named Elysia, whose existence was a tapestry woven from the very fabric of their destinies. Elysia was not an ordinary human; she was the fulcrum upon which the triangle's balance rested. The love triangle between the three ancient beings was a silent, unspoken bond, a silent dance of power and vulnerability.
As the ages passed, the Triangle of Fates watched over Elysia, guiding her steps, shaping her life. But with the rise of the dark sorcerer, Zephyrion, who sought to unravel the threads of fate, the triangle's balance was threatened. Zephyrion's ambition was to claim Elysia for his own, to harness her connection to the Triangle of Fates for his own purposes.
The triangle's redemption began with a whisper. A whisper that reached the ears of a young scribe named Thalor, who had spent his life chronicling the legends of Aeloria. Thalor was a man of great curiosity and a gentle heart, and when the whisper spoke of the triangle's crisis, he knew he had to act.
Thalor set out on a journey to seek out the three ancient beings, each of whom was living out their lives in hiding. He found Aelion in the heart of the Whispering Forest, where the trees whispered secrets of old and the wind carried the songs of the ancients. Aelion, with his golden wings and eyes that held the light of the sun, revealed the extent of the threat and the importance of Elysia's role in the triangle's redemption.
Next, Thalor journeyed to the shadowed peaks of the Arcane Mountains, where Ilios resided, his form shifting and changing with the elements around him. Ilios, a being of ethereal beauty and boundless knowledge, spoke of the arcane's power that was at the heart of Zephyrion's dark sorcery. The scribe learned that only by uniting the arcane with the living could they hope to counter Zephyrion's dark influence.
Lastly, Thalor traveled to the Dreaming Isles, where Lyria lay in slumber, her dreams a mirror to the world's soul. Here, Thalor was shown the depths of Lyria's despair, her connection to Elysia's destiny frayed by Zephyrion's machinations. He understood that without the triangle's full power, Elysia would be lost to the sorcerer's clutches.
With the ancient beings' guidance, Thalor returned to Elysia, who was now entangled in Zephyrion's web of lies and deceit. The young scribe, driven by the whisper of fate, confronted Zephyrion in a climactic battle. The air crackled with arcane energy as the sorcerer's dark magic clashed with the Triangle of Fates' combined will.
The triangle's redemption unfolded in a series of unexpected twists. Aelion's strength was matched by Elysia's courage, Ilios' arcane knowledge unlocked the secrets of the Triangle's origin, and Lyria's dreams wove a tapestry of hope that enveloped them all. In the heart of the battle, Elysia discovered the true nature of her connection to the triangle, her role as the fulcrum of fate becoming clear.
As the triangle's power surged within her, Elysia broke free from Zephyrion's control, her will as strong as the ancient beings'. With a final, devastating strike, Elysia shattered the sorcerer's dark amulet, releasing the triangle's full power. The Triangle of Fates was restored, and with it, the balance of fate.
In the aftermath, the Triangle of Fates returned to their silent vigil, their balance once again intact. Elysia, now a part of the triangle's history, lived out her days in peace, her heart forever bound to the ancient beings who had protected her.
Thalor returned to his life as a scribe, his story of the triangle's redemption preserved in the annals of Aeloria. The tale of the Triangle's Redemption became a legend, a reminder of the power of love, fate, and redemption. And in the whispers of the wind, the Triangle of Fates continued to watch over their beloved Elysia, ever vigilant, ever protective, ever bound by the unbreakable triangle.
